Dear [hiring manager's name], I first want to thank you for the time you've taken with me during the hiring process and for considering me for the [title of the job you're applying for] at [name of organization]. I regret to say that I'm writing to let you know that I have decided to withdraw my application.
Once you decide to withdraw, promptly communicate that with the hiring team. In your email, keep the tone friendly and express your gratitude. ?You want to exit as positively as possible,? she says. So there's no need to detail the reasons you're withdrawing, which could seem like critiques.
